What is the formula for calculating the circumference of a circle?

Back

Circumference = π × diameter or Circumference = 2 × π × radius.

What is the relationship between diameter and radius?

Back

Diameter is twice the radius (Diameter = 2 × radius).

How do you find the radius from the circumference?

Back

Radius = Circumference / (2 × π).
